Fire destroys outbuilding in Callaway County

CALLAWAY COUNTY, Mo. (KMIZ)

A Callaway County family lost an outbuilding in a fire in Callaway County on Wednesday morning.

The fire at 2805 Route F near Fulton burned up a storage shed, including a Chevrolet Camaro, was called in a little after 9 a.m., said Millerburg Fire Chief Larry Curtis. Curtis said the fire could put off smoke for about two days.

The owner was able to get a few tractors out of the shed before the fire got too big, Curtis said. No one was injured.

Firefighters spent over an hour putting out the blaze.
